MySQL查询用户主要涉及到数据库的用户管理和权限控制。以下是关于MySQL查询用户的一些基础概念、优势、类型、应用场景,以及可能遇到的问题和解决方法。
MySQL中的用户是用于连接和管理数据库的实体。每个用户都有自己的用户名和密码,并且可以被授予或拒绝访问数据库中特定对象(如表、视图、存储过程等)的权限。
你可以使用以下SQL语句来查询MySQL中的用户:
SELECT User, Host FROM mysql.user;
这条语句将列出所有已创建的用户及其允许连接的主机。
CREATE USER
语句来创建新用户。C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
GRANT
语句来授予权限。GRANT SELECT, INSERT ON mydatabase.* TO 'newuser'@'localhost';
通过了解这些基础概念和解决方法,你可以更有效地管理和查询MySQL中的用户。
领取专属 10元无门槛券
手把手带您无忧上云